Xiaodan Yao is a scholar working on Molecular Biology, Immunology and Oncology. According to data from OpenAlex, Xiaodan Yao has authored 12 papers receiving a total of 137 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 6 papers in Immunology and 3 papers in Oncology. Recurrent topics in Xiaodan Yao's work include Cancer Mechanisms and Therapy (2 papers), CRISPR and Genetic Engineering (2 papers) and Peptidase Inhibition and Analysis (2 papers). Xiaodan Yao is often cited by papers focused on Cancer Mechanisms and Therapy (2 papers), CRISPR and Genetic Engineering (2 papers) and Peptidase Inhibition and Analysis (2 papers). Xiaodan Yao collaborates with scholars based in United States, China and Japan. Xiaodan Yao's co-authors include Shumei Song, Jaffer A. Ajani, Ailing W. Scott, Melissa Pool Pizzi, Lang Ma, Jiankang Jin, Yanting Zhang, Dipti Athavale, Curt Balch and Linghua Wang and has published in prestigious journals such as PLoS ONE, Cancer Research and Gut.
